+ | Year | Australian Open | French Open | Wimbledon | US Open |
+ | 2003 | United States Andre Agassi | Spain Juan Carlos Ferrero | Switzerland Roger Federer | United States Andy Roddick |
+ | 2004 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Argentina Gastón Gaudio | Switzerland Roger Federer | Switzerland Roger Federer |
+ | 2005 | Russia Marat Safin |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| Switzerland Roger Federer |
+ | 2006 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| Switzerland Roger Federer |
+ | 2007 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| Switzerland Roger Federer |
+ | 2008 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Spain Rafael Nadal |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er |
+ | 2009 |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| Switzerland Roger Federer | Argentina Juan Martín del Potro |
+ | 2010 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al | Spain Rafael Nadal | Spain Rafael Nadal |
+ | 2011 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Spain Rafael Nadal |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Serbia Novak Djokovic |
+ | 2012 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| United Kingdom Andy Murray |
+ | 2013 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Spain Rafael Nadal | United Kingdom Andy Murray | Spain Rafael Nadal |
+ | 2014 | Switzerland Stan Wawrinka | Spain Rafael Nadal |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Croatia Marin Čilić |
+ | 2015 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Switzerland Stan Wawrinka |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Serbia Novak Djokovic |
+ | 2016 |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Serbia Novak Djokovic | United Kingdom Andy Murray | Switzerland Stan Wawrinka |
+ | 2017 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al |
+ | 2018 | Switzerland Roger Federer | Spain Rafael Nadal | Serbia Novak Djokovic | Serbia Novak Djokovic |
